HOME-MADE SKI WORKSHOP
You come to Livigno for the "Skieda" (form the 1st to the 8th of April), you spend the day skiing, do some work in the lab, and in the evening it is patytime. After 3/4 days you go back home with your own self-made skis.
It will probably cost between 150 and 200euros, materials, gloves, protections and everything else included.

Huf...
After a week I have found 5 minutes.

So far, we pressed already about 15 pairs, and in the afternoon we will do the last 4. Made super sidecut skis (12m radius), reverse sidecut, super fat skis, straight skis, reverse camber skis; used glass and carbon.
We had up to two pressing sessions per day: working in the morning, then hardcore skiing, few more hours in the late afternoon and then parting in the night...
